Position Summary:

Responsible for setting up and running exercise and chemical stress tests while collecting data (EKG and Vital signs) based on provider orders, clinical assessment and protocols. Supervise individuals during therapeutic exercise sessions, ensuring safety. Provide education for people with cardiac disease, or high-risk individuals, based on client assessment or testing. Prepares and cleans exercise and testing equipment. Accurately records physiological data. Guides patients through programs, offering motivation and answering questions. Responsible for recognizing and responding to emergency situations, following appropriate emergency protocols.

What the Exercise Physiologist will do:

  • Demonstrates knowledge and indications for different types of stress tests.
  •  Performs diagnostic cardiac exercise stress test on symptomatic cardiac patients. Types of stress tests this position performs include: Treadmill stress test (may also include an echocardiogram following the treadmill portion); Nuclear stress test; Pharmacologic stress test
  • Works collaboratively with cardiac sonographers, nuclear medical technologists and registered nurses.
  • Follows THGR Cardiovascular protocols for the following: patient assessment, preparation, ECG monitoring for changes, test quality and monitoring patient within the recovery stage.
  • Communicates with the Cardiologist regarding any significant abnormal ECG changes.
  • Documents appropriate information throughout the entirety for physician interpretation.
  • Responsible for cleaning equipment, and for equipment repair notification.
  • Designs, implements and evaluates exercise prescriptions and including appropriate documentation.
  • Educates patients independently and in collaboration with the registered nurse regarding healthy lifestyle and changes related to their disease process.
  • Develops, implements and evaluates programs to promote cardiovascular disease recognition and treatment.
  • Ensures appropriate compensation for services provided via appropriate pre-approval and billing processes.
  • Responsible for cleaning of equipment, equipment repair notification and keeping exercise clutter free.

What the Exercise Physiologist will need:

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Health Science or related field.
  • Basic Cardiac Life Support (BCLS) certification
  • Clinical stress testing or cardiac rehab internship/observation.
  • Preferred: American College of Sports Medicine (ACSM) Exercise Specialist certification.
  • Preferred: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) certification
  • Preferred: One year of experience in related field
